Understanding Roulette and Its Betting Options
Roulette is a game of chance with numerous betting options, ranging from straightforward color bets to individual numbers. The most common variants are American, European, and French roulette, each with slightly different rules and house edges. While the game is primarily luck-based, some players enjoy adopting strategies or betting patterns, especially when choosing specific numbers. Knowing how these bets work is the first step to understanding how to pick the best number to bet on.
Types of Bets in Roulette
- Inside Bets: These include bets on specific numbers or small groups of numbers. Examples are straight bets (single number), split bets (two adjacent numbers), and corner bets (four numbers). Inside bets generally have higher payouts but lower chances of winning.
- Outside Bets: These are bets on broader categories such as red or black, odd or even, or high (19-36) and low (1-18). Outside bets are more conservative with higher chances but smaller payouts.
Factors to Consider When Choosing a Number
While roulette is fundamentally a game of chance, players often look for patterns, hot numbers, or personal favorites. Here are key factors to consider when selecting a number:
1. Understanding Payouts and Probabilities
Different bets offer different odds and payouts. For example, a straight-up bet on a single number pays 35:1 but has a roughly 2.7% chance (European roulette) or 2.6% chance (American roulette) of winning. Recognizing these odds helps you decide whether to stick with safer bets or take the riskier but more lucrative options.
2. Hot and Cold Numbers
Some players track the wheel’s results to identify “hot” numbers (those that have appeared frequently) or “cold” numbers (those that haven’t). While this pattern tracking can add an element of strategy, it’s crucial to understand that each spin is independent, and previous outcomes do not influence future results.
3. Personal Intuition and Lucky Numbers
Many players have personal lucky numbers or favorite digits they always wager on. While this doesn’t affect the odds, it adds an element of enjoyment and personal connection to the game.
Strategies for Selecting Numbers in Online Roulette
Many seasoned players adopt specific strategies to determine which numbers to bet on, although no method guarantees consistent wins due to the game’s inherent randomness. Some popular approaches include:
Martingale Strategy
This involves doubling your bet after each loss, aiming to recover previous losses once you win. While this can be effective in the short term, it requires a sizable bankroll and can hit table limits quickly.
Fibonacci Sequence
Betting following the Fibonacci sequence (1, 1, 2, 3, 5, 8, etc.) can help manage bets systematically, but like other strategies, it doesn’t influence the game’s randomness.
Choosing “Balanced” Numbers
Some players prefer to select numbers that cover various sections of the wheel, such as mixing high and low, odd and even numbers, in hopes of increasing their chances of hitting a winning spot.
